•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

CraftAcademy / homechef / 42
94%

Build:
DEFAULT BRANCH: develop
Ran 13 Jan 2017 02:02PM UTC
Jobs 1
Files 11
Run time 1s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

pending completion
42

push

travis-ci

tochman
Feature: Payment (#6)

* Adds act as shopping cart gem

* Create model and migrate for shopping cart

* Create model and migrate shopping cart item

* Create feature and step file

* Made intial acceptance test pass, creates a cart and adds dishes to it

* Add button for pay

* Add stripe gem

* Create controller and route for stripe

* Adds stripe initializer and refactors stripe controller

* Creates view in layout for stripe

* Adds new and create view for stripe

* Configures stripe to charge the total price of all items in the shoppingcart

* Changes stripe message + removes typo from charges controller

* Make checkout page with routes - test failing

* Removes shoppingcart and shoppingcartitem models and all their dependencies

* Removes shoppingcart and shoppingcartitems rspec

* Add poltergeist for javscript and create step definition for card info

* Add step definition for form, test pass BUT add button with totalamount

* Change card number to valid card number

* Removes unnecessary step definition for payment feature

* Makes api keys for stripe secret

* Adds screenshot gem + tries to fix issues with acceptance tests(failing)

* Makes final acceptance tests pass for making a payment with stripe

* Fixes an acceptance test (Passing)

* adds web mock and stripe moch  + configures stripe hooks
refactors step definitions for stripe steps
refactors poltergaist configuration

* updates to PhantomJS 2.1.1 for CI env

* refactors variable name in view and landing controller

* removes comments in landing controller

* restores charges_path /my mistake..

41 of 47 relevant lines covered (87.23%)

1.47 hits per line

Jobs
ID Job ID Ran Files Coverage
1 42.1 (2.3.1) 13 Jan 2017 02:02PM UTC 0
87.23
Travis Job 42.1
Source Files on build 42
Detailed source file information is not available for this build.
  • Back to Repo
  • Travis Build #42
  • a40cd2bd on github
  • Prev Build on develop (#39)
  • Next Build on develop (#48)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c